Keeping kids engaged and busy during quarantine might be a challenge for parents. As most schools have been shut down temporarily due to lockdown, kids are staying at home right now. Abundance of time and lack of outdoor and playground access have made most kids utterly bored.
Some have become cranky while others are indulging in all sorts of pranks and mischief to kill their boredom. Now, as a parent how can you keep your little one engaged and interested in a meaningful way during this quarantine phase? All you need for this game is a pen and a paper. This is one of the simplest games that you have also played in your childhood probably. In this game a grid is drawn on a paper and two players playing the game seek to complete a diagonal or a column or a row with signs like three ‘X’ or three ‘O’.
This is a song-based game where one contestant sings a song’s first verse making sure that the song starts with the consonant with which the song sung by the previous contestant ends.
This is one of the most popular indoor games. If you are a movie buff or can act well this game is a great option for you. In this game you’ll have to enact the movie name when it’s your turn while the other contestant will guess the name of the movie by seeing your enactment.

In this game of ‘Musical Chair’ a couple of chairs will be there and the players will have to go round the chairs while the music is on. The very moment the music stops the players will have to find a chair to sit on. One who fails to find a chair is out of the game.
